Vehicle Profile: The 2013 Chevrolet Malibu Eco
Challenging the midsize status quo.

Photo: The 2013 Chevrolet Malibu Eco
In 2008, GM released the seventh generation Malibu and turned the midsize car world on its head. Universally praised for its modern styling and beautiful interior, the Malibu was a hit. Not content to merely rely on its past awards and allow competitors to catch up, GM is introducing the world to the all-new, eighth-generation Chevrolet Malibu. With enhanced style, improved interior and a groundbreaking new powertrain, the all-new 2013 Chevrolet Malibu Eco is poised to add a big dose of spice and efficiency to the midsize sedan segment.

The Chickenpox Challenge
Info and tips for dealing with this itchy virus, especially when your child is sick.

Photo: The Chickenpox Challenge
Although adults can get chickenpox, childhood is often the time when individuals experience the virus. According to KidsHealth, part of the Nemours Foundation, chickenpox is caused by the virus varicella zoster. Symptoms include a rash of blister-like spots, itchy skin and sometimes general cold symptoms. Usually, chickenpox is an irritating, yet mild illness; however, some complications can occur. Car Care: When it’s Your 35,000-Mile Service
Simple tips can help save your investment.

Photo: When it’s Your 35,000-Mile Service
At less than 35,000 miles, most new cars are still under warranty, so anything that breaks prematurely, such as a leaking brake caliper or a burned out wiper motor, should be fixed at no cost. However, warranties don’t generally cover wear and tear items like brake pads and wiper blades, so it’s important to check those regularly and replace as needed for proper function and safety. Regular maintenance is important to protect your investment and prevent problems later, after that new-car warranty expires.
